Output d2c52150159e5a6ada3f827f61ddccaeb5347ec9ea34a6078f9cbe51a03ba445:164

value
9096844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8e583a9c0ee014ea4b15ebffd97b2fbe4a2393 OP_EQUAL
address
3JhS8W9yzFvm51vLJ9y6YqdTzznji9xLjU
transaction
d2c52150159e5a6ada3f827f61ddccaeb5347ec9ea34a6078f9cbe51a03ba445
spent
true